Understanding the World Series of Darts

Before we jump into today's specific schedule, let's quickly recap what the World Series of Darts is all about. This prestigious tournament brings together some of the best darts players from around the globe, creating a dynamic and competitive environment. The Amsterdam leg of the series is always a highlight, drawing huge crowds and generating intense excitement. The format typically involves a series of knockout matches, leading to the crowning of a champion. Each match is a test of skill, precision, and mental fortitude, making it a captivating spectacle for fans worldwide.

The World Series events are not just about the competition; they are also about showcasing the sport to a broader audience. By hosting events in various international locations like Amsterdam, the Professional Darts Corporation (PDC) aims to grow the popularity of darts and attract new fans. The Amsterdam event, in particular, benefits from the city's vibrant atmosphere and enthusiastic sports fans. The tournament often features local players alongside international stars, adding an extra layer of intrigue and national pride. Keep an eye out for any local favorites who might be looking to make a splash on the big stage!

Moreover, the World Series of Darts plays a crucial role in the PDC's broader strategy of globalizing the sport. These events provide a platform for players from different countries to compete against the world's best, fostering a sense of international camaraderie and competition. The exposure gained from these tournaments can be career-changing for emerging players, offering them opportunities to gain ranking points, prize money, and recognition on a global scale. Amsterdam's Darts Scene: A Local Perspective

Amsterdam isn't just a beautiful city; it's also a hotbed for darts enthusiasts. The local darts scene is vibrant and passionate, contributing to the electric atmosphere of the World Series event. Understanding the local context can add another layer of appreciation to the tournament, as you'll gain insight into the city's unique relationship with the sport. From local pubs hosting weekly tournaments to passionate fans packing the arena, Amsterdam's love for darts is palpable.

The Dutch have a strong tradition in darts, with several world-class players hailing from the Netherlands. This creates a sense of national pride and excitement when the World Series comes to Amsterdam. The local fans are known for their enthusiastic support, creating a lively and energetic atmosphere that can be both inspiring for the players and entertaining for the viewers. When you watch the tournament, pay attention to the crowd reactions and the way they get behind their local heroes. It's a unique and captivating aspect of the Amsterdam event.

Moreover, the World Series of Darts event has a positive impact on the local economy and community. It brings in tourists, generates revenue for local businesses, and showcases Amsterdam as a premier sporting destination. The event also inspires young people to take up the sport, contributing to the growth and development of darts in the Netherlands.
